Yo Henmi
 
Yo Henmi (1944~) was born in Miyagi. After working as a correspondent for a news service agency, he started writing novels.
AWARDS
1991 Akutagawa Prize, for Jido Kisho Sochi (Automatic Wake-up Device)
1994 Kodansha Nonfiction Prize, for Mono kuu Hitobito (People who East)
2011 Nakahara Chuya Prize, for Namakubi (Severed Head)
2012 Takami Jun Prize, for Me no Umi (Sea of Eyeballs)
